The gist
This PhD internship focuses on improving AI model performance on AMD hardware. You'll profile and optimize training and inference workloads using cutting-edge tools. Ideal for PhD students with experience in deep learning and GPU programming.
What you would actually do
- Optimize AI models and training workflows on AMD GPUs
- Use ROCm, PyTorch, JAX, and performance tools for benchmarking
- Work with engineers on GPU performance analysis and optimization
